  • PPE;
    1. Local guidance from SCC/NHS on use of PPE has now been circulated. This offers some consistency during the current shortage of PPE. PHE now recommends that organisations conduct a dynamic risk assessed approach to organisational use of PPE using Table 4 as its point of reference.  THIS remains the key document and is the standard that we should all be looking to achieve.

  • SCC financial support package; now been approved and circulated with payments underway, (SCC Provider Premium Decision Paper 220420). Note that this does not include day services, DP’s or private funders. The council is open to consider these cases on a bespoke case-by-case basis.

    4. Somerset Training Hub and Somerset Covid19 End of Life Group/Cell have made available a series of online educational resources to help health and care workers with providing end of life care in the community during Covid-19. There will 10 in all and are all being placed on the Somerset General Practice Education Trust SGPET website. SGPET has removed the need for any log in or registration and the online courses can now be viewed by all. The eight up so far can be seen at: HERE
